Ok so seeing you live in Colorado there is one weird limitation you have, you can't have magazines that hold more than 15 rounds statewide, or 10 in boulder. The statewide limit isn't really enforced outside of boulder and you can buy "high capacity" magazine build kits which are just a disassembled magazine you can put together in a lot of gun shops from what i've heard.

A .22lr gun is pretty ideal as a first gun to train the fundamentals on due to its low recoil and cost, but you want a self defense gun, and .22lr is not ideal for that. It's pretty small(still lethal) but it's a rimfire round, which means the reliability isn't as good as a centerfire round.
You did talk about long guns vs handguns and for someone learning how to shoot guns a long gun is ideal to start on. They have less recoil, are more accurate, and are easier to control in general due to their size.

A shotgun works for home defense and is cheap, but they're not good for range shooting unless you're using slug rounds, which are expensive(50 cents a round or so). A rifle would probably be more ideal, AR15s are affordable and pistol caliber carbines like the hi point or the ruger PCC are good as well.

A mossberg maverick 88(pump shotgun) can be had for about $200 while an AR15 or Ruger PCC would cost about $400-500, the hi point carbine is $300ish

Also if you're considering an AR there are 3 good budget choices
1. Cheapest option, Palmetto State Armory
2. Smith and Wesson M&P15
3. Ruger AR556

There's also the Ruger MPR which costs about $600 but also requires you to add an optic which can cost about $100 for a decent one, that's a step up from the budget tier
